Buena Vida Odessa has inspired a wide range of experiences from families and visitors, with many pages of praise mingled with a substantial number of serious concerns. On the plus side, several reviewers describe the facility as clean and well-kept, with a remodel that makes the place feel fresh and inviting. They highlight a strong rehab program, a spacious rehab gym, and a generally friendly, responsive staff. Families repeatedly mention that the environment can be bright and positive, and that the care teams try to do right by their loved ones, especially when it comes to rehabilitation and managing treatment plans.
At the same time, a sizable portion of the feedback centers on troubling gaps in care and communication. Some families report shocking situations where their loved ones were left outside or not properly supervised, leading to health scares and involvement from protective services. There are stories of pneumonia, emergency room visits, and even mentions of a resident being dropped or mishandled during transfers or daily care. Diet and medical needs - such as renal dialysis restrictions or diabetic diets - are described as frequently ignored or inconsistently followed. In one case, a relative was said to have received up to three cups of coffee despite clear instructions, underscoring concerns about basic daily care and medical management.
Several reviews describe deteriorating conditions over time, with alarming observations about weight loss and bruising that some families felt were not adequately investigated or explained. The sentiment many readers come away with is that some staff members were overwhelmed, inattentive, or inadequately trained, and that this translated into missed showers, inconsistent attention, and a sense that the needs of elderly residents were not always prioritized. The atmosphere in some reports is described as tense, with accusations that staff members spoke in front of patients in Spanish to hide or disregard issues, and that some employees were dismissive or unhelpful when families asked for help or clarification.
There are also strong personal testimonies about specific individuals and roles within Buena Vida. Some families praise the administrators and financial coordinators for their responsiveness and willingness to accommodate families, noting that communications like family reviews and even FaceTime updates helped keep them connected when they could not be there in person. One review stresses high praise for Administrator Silvia Casas and for staff member Janie who handles finances, along with compliments for Sylvia who maintains a clean, up-to-date facility and works to provide metabolic or beauty services for the family. This kind of praise contrasts sharply with other accounts of staff turnover, "Now Hiring" signs, and complaints about rude or condescending behavior from certain team members, including an activity director and several specific staffers.
A common thread among the negative reviews is a fear that Buena Vida, despite its apparent strengths, may not be the steady, trustworthy home families hoped for. Several commenters believe the facility once enjoyed a strong reputation but that the quality of care has declined over the past year as staff changes occurred. The concerns extend to whether the place truly prioritizes the dignity and safety of residents, rather than focusing on appearances, cost-cutting, or rapid turnover. The sentiment is clear: for some families, Buena Vida may offer good amenities and a pleasant atmosphere, but for others it feels like a place where serious care issues and interpersonal challenges overshadow the positives.

Buena Vida Nursing And Rehab - Odessa in Odessa, TX is an assisted living community that offers a wide range of amenities and care services to ensure the comfort and well-being of its residents.
The community features a beauty salon where residents can pamper themselves, as well as cable or satellite TV for entertainment. Community operated transportation is available to help residents travel to various destinations, such as shopping centers or social events.
For those who enjoy technology, there is a computer center equipped with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access. Meals are served in a dining room with restaurant-style dining, and there is also a kitchenette available for residents who prefer to prepare their own meals.
Residents can stay active and fit at the fitness room or participate in various activities offered at the gaming room and small library. Outdoor space and gardens provide beautiful surroundings for relaxation and enjoyment of nature.
Housekeeping services ensure that the living spaces are clean and tidy, while move-in coordination helps make the transition into the community seamless. Private bathrooms offer convenience and privacy, and telephone services are available for communication needs.
The community provides non-medical transportation arrangements for residents, including transportation to doctors' appointments. A wellness center offers resources and support for maintaining good health.
In terms of care services, there is a 24-hour call system for assistance whenever needed. Trained staff members provide 24-hour supervision to ensure the safety of residents. Assistance with activities of daily living, such as bathing, dressing, and transfers, is available.
Special dietary restrictions are accommodated through diabetes diets and other specific dietary plans. Meal preparation and service are provided, ensuring that residents receive nutritious meals tailored to their needs. Medication management ensures that medications are taken correctly.
Mental wellness programs promote emotional well-being among residents. Transportation arrangements are made for non-medical needs.
A variety of activities are offered to keep residents engaged and entertained. Concierge services assist in fulfilling any special requests or arrangements. Fitness programs promote physical fitness, while planned day trips and resident-run activities provide social interaction and entertainment.
The community is conveniently located near several c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ians, restaurants, theaters, and hospitals, making it easily accessible for residents to enjoy nearby amenities and access necessary healthcare services.

Hospice care focuses on providing comfort and support for individuals nearing the end of life, with Medicare Part A covering services like nursing care and counseling for patients with a terminal illness and a life expectancy of six months or less. While most hospice services are low-cost for eligible patients, families should be aware that certain expenses, such as room and board, may not be covered.
